Graduate Research Assistant

Position begins in September 2017

Research Project: Professional role identity change to accommodate medical assistance in dying: A qualitative analysis of four professions in Nova Scotia

Project information: The objectives of this research are: 1. To understand changes in the professional roles and identity of physicians, nurses, pharmacists and healthcare administrators in Nova Scotia after the practice of medical assistance in dying (MAID) became legal in Canada in 2016 and 2. To develop preliminary practice models of MAID to understand the processes by which it takes place.
